A 10 -year -old boy reported by TAFT, California, was found on Sunday after, the authorities alleged that the child was kidnapped by a 27 -year -old man who had communicated through the popular Roblox Games site and the Discord messaging platform, said the Kern County Sheriff’s office on Wednesday.
Matthew Macatuno Naval was accused of kidnapping and illegal sexual behavior with a minor, authorities said.
The child was last seen by the family at home on Saturday night, and the police was sent the next morning after the young people were reported as missing.
The detectives discovered the communications between the child and a man who identified as Naval and believed that he was in the Elk Grove area, just south of Sacramento and more than 250 miles from the child’s house in TAFT, police said.
Elk Grove police were notified, and found Naval in a shopping center near their home with El NiƱo, according to the statement.
“The suspect was found by collaboration with Elk Grove PD and with the help of the Sacramento’s media response to the missing brochures sent by Kcso, and our local media partners here in Kern County,” said Sheriff’s spokeswoman Lori Meza, to the NBC KGET affiliate from Bakersfield. “We are sure that spreading the word so quickly contributed to the successful location of the victim and the suspect.”
The 10 -year -old was temporarily taken to protective custody before being released to the family, authorities said.
Naval was hired in jail and transferred on Wednesday to Kern County, and a complaint is expected to be presented on Friday, Bee Sacrament said.
It is not immediately clear if Naval has a lawyer.
Other states have taken legal measures against such online sites, asking for greater child protection.
Florida’s attorney general James Uthmeier issued a citation on Wednesday to Roblox, demanding information about his marketing, age verification and compilation of children’s data.
“We intend to cooperate with the Office of the Attorney General and we hope to share all the work that Roblox does to help keep users safe,” said a Roblox spokesman.
New Jersey Attorney, Matthew Pathin, announced a lawsuit on Thursday against Discord, claiming “deceptive and excessive commercial practices that deceived parents about the effectiveness of their security controls and obscured the risks that the children faced when using the application.”
Discord said in a statement: “Discord is proud of our continuous efforts and investments in characteristics and tools that help make Discord safer. Given our commitment to the Office of the Attorney General, we are surprised by the announcement that New Jersey has presented an action against Discord today. We discuss the claims in the lawsuit and hope to defend the action in court.”
In California, the Kern County Sheriff’s office reminded the community with the importance of internet security in the light of the recent incident.
“The parents, monitor all electronic use and know who their children communicate with,” said the statement. “Many applications and games have messaging capabilities and present the same risk, if not more, as social media platforms.”
